tell me about drawtectives. what is this little show.
oooooh my god oh my god. they are my guys. so.
drawtectives itself is a youtube series created by julia lepetit on Drawfee. it's an rpg mystery show– s1 is a murder mystery, s2 is just a mystery– that doubles as an art challenges show. she draws all of the backgrounds and npcs and most of the assets (the 'cutscenes', you could call them) and then the team gets together, knowing absolutely nothing besides what julia's asked them to prepare, and does some funky improv to create a very funky storyline.
there are 3 players and one dm; the pcs are rosé, york, and grendan/grenda/grandma/gma, and the Big NPCs are Jancy True (s1/s2) and Eugene Finch (s2) and they're, in their own words, a found family, so. beloved. their backup plan if all their jobs fail is to move out east and open a bookstore. jancy and eugene have fully accepted their titles as mom/ancestral ghost and son despite meeting each other likely once before the drawtectives dragged them together. overall though if i had to summarize, it's a bunch of friends getting together, making a bunch of puns, appreciating julia's art, and laughing together. the vibes are 10/10 so loving. in writing the transcripts i've written (Karina laughs) (Nathan laughs) (All laugh) So Many Times it's just fun.
so there's three pcs. first one we meet is gyorik 'york' rogdul, who's a half-orc come to the city to learn about his mother's culture. he is the character we have by far the most lore for– if I compiled all the lore I had about the Northern Tribes and Wild Trains, I think the document would be multiple pages. he's also illiterate, which was an interesting decision for the english major of the group to make (in other words, York Will Not Be Illiterate For Season Three bc Y'all Cannot Read) and morally gray if you think about it too hard (he killed his own brother) but yknow he's hot so it's okay. they're all hot any crimes committed are okay. he's also aroace (confirmed by the player, which is!! vibes!! THANK YOU SO MUCH FOR TELLING ME @axolotllee!)
rosé is the Human Rogue and the youngest of the party; her main trait in s1 was Millennial and she Dealt with that. she, in contrast with York, has so little lore we are scraping the barrel. she was a thief, then left everything about that life behind and changed her name to rosé when she went to work for jancy. she lied on her resumé. she knows how to sew; she's sewn Pockets of Holding on most of her clothing. she bonded with a stray cat that lived outside her last apartment. she's three credits short of graduating college. she's, in addition to being a drawtective, jancy's intern, and cried when jancy got her a cupcake. she won't tell her best friends when her birthday is or where she goes to school or what her last name is. that's all we know about her and i love her and she could probably kill someone as she has multiple knives on her person and does not use them. she's bright and funny and can be pretty dark but really does find the humor in it which is. wonderful.
so grendan highforge starts out as The Snobby Rich Boy which. already love the trope something Always Happens To Them if they're a pc. then through s1 they make an offhand comment about a character (faucon, whose name is pronounced 'falco') and how if her name was pronounced that way it'd be grenda. faucon asks how they feel about it. they are caught very off-guard by that and then ask to be called it for the next hour or so. then the next witness calls him gma, and then grandma, and then. yeah she realizes she's genderfluid. and he uses any pronouns and has a full beard and also wears a romper and loves dogs and the player is the Most Experienced TTRPG-er so through maybe using resources a bittt grandma is the most observant character of all of them. he's also a dog walker and a lightweight and does canonically have druidic magic though that was Not Touched On Much and showed up to their first day on the job slightly stoned (they did stop doing that though.) she carries around a box to make the height difference (york is 7'. grendan is 4'. rosé is 6'. you can see the formatting issue) slightly less difficult. she doesn't know how rhinos reproduce but has had a fascination with them since a police chief said one might've committed a crime. i think they could kill someone by talking too much but they don't actually have the strength or dex to do Jack Shit.
and jancy true is the head pi (a great many of the characters are puns and i love it so much) and is there to make sure things get done and clues don't get missed. she has a cochlear implant and uses a cane and solved s1 just by Reading The Paper and hearsay. she solved about half of s2 before Someone Stopped Her. she says hello children to the drawtectives and it is such a fond thing. eugene is. a guy who i love. julia started the show thinking he would be some mysterious character to join them and then made the wonderful improv decision– avoiding having to do npc-npc conversation– of saying 'yeah eugene is spinning a camera on its stand' and rosé just says so gleefully. 'guys. i think he's stupid.' and he became their son. his character is a lot of The Plot of s2 so i don't want to get into it too much but. jancy and eugene my beloved.
they're just. such a family. to quote nathan (grenda's Player) from the s2 talkback: "That's one of my favorite things about this show, is we came in with these vague ideas for characters, and just playing them with each other, they became friends and became better people as a result of knowing each other and solving mysteries. ... Like, we all kind of independently made our characters people that either were distant from their families or, you know, just had tenuous connections to other stuff, and so these are, like, the realest connections they have in their lives."
and then karina (rosé) about 10 seconds later: "Yeah, we love a found family where they bond over just being the worst."
god. them. they're chaotic and loud and feel very real to me. they have excitement and are pretty bad at social cues but they love each other and want to die together because they would hate too much to be separated. i could articulate this better but it's one in the morning and they mean a great deal to me.

Weird thing none of you know about me: from about 2015(?) until about 2019 or so, I had a very specific and weird obsession: Lisa Frank's social media presence (and, to a lesser degree, Lisa Frank's collaboration deals clearly made in an attempt at making a comeback).
Now, I will go ahead and correct a commonly held misconception amongst the people who followed me on Facebook at the time: I was not obsessed with Lisa Frank the person (as mysterious as she attempts to be, I think I have her mostly figured out), Lisa Frank the manufacturer of my favorite childhood school supplies, or even Lisa Frank the company as it stands today (though this Jezebel article, Inside the Rainbow Gulag: The Technicolor Rise and Fall of Lisa Frank, is wild and I think everyone should read it; it may not hold true today since they've had so much change and turnover, but it's still fascinating). My obsession was primarily focused on Lisa Frank's social media presence. And that's because Lisa Frank's social media presence was batshit insane.
Keep in mind, when I first started following them on social media, they were not banking on Millennial nostalgia. They were still primarily selling school supplies. The adult coloring book (not adult like smutty; adult like...those therapy coloring books that were so popular ten years ago?) sold by way of an exclusivity agreement with Dollar General hadn't been announced yet, nor had workout gear or the SpongeBob collab (sold only at HotTopic). As far as anyone knew, Lisa Frank was still that rainbow school supply company whose target audience is nine-year-old girls.
Which is why all of the housemade "memes" were absolutely bonkers.

Book Review 28 – Finna by Nino Cipri
Tumblr media
This was another slim book I picked up basically blind entirely so I had something fast on hand to read. Unfortunately, didn’t work out nearly so well for me as most of the other’s I’ve read. Which is a shame, because the fundamental idea behind it is incredible, or at least seemed like an excuse for a kind of ridiculous pulpy adventure that was just made for me.
So, the story’s about a pair of 20-something queer dead-enders working at a bigbox furniture story that is similar to but legally distinct from Ikea. The Monday after they broke up, they find themselves both working a shift at the same time. And, even more awkwardly, after a transient wormhole forms and a customer wanders into a parallel universe’s not!Ikea, the two of them are volunteered to go rescue the wold woman. From this follows adventures through wild and deadly alternate realities, self-discovery, realizing how much there is out in the world, post-breakup reconciliation, a moment of dramatic self-actualization-through-heroic-sacrifice, and so on and et cetera.
Now, there are good qualities to this book, but I will be honest that the weeks since I’ve read it have dulled my memory of everything except the petty annoyances. So this review is basically just going to be complaining about what I thought didn’t work or irked me out of all proportion to its significance. Okay? Okay.
So fundamentally this feels like this could have been a fun, cheesy absurd comedy about some #relatable millennials trapped in retail purgatory and all its kafkaesque upbeat cheer. Tragically it was written by someone whose memories or ideas of what that’s like were warped by too many years on twitter and around people being professionally writer for the book to ever really ring true (to me, at least).
Or, possibly better put, it felt like the book was trying to tell me what sort of story it was and what emotional journeys its characters were going on and what it was trying to satirize more than it ever followed through on any of it? Which is pretty unhelpfully vague as a complain, I’m aware.
More concretely, the emotional arc of the two leads just felt incredibly rushed – these did not feel like two people who had had a messy breakup after an incredible hurtful argument three days before! They were, at most, slightly awkward around each other, and inside of fifty pages they were friends again. Which was just deeply emotionally unsatisfying for what the back cover sold the book as, or for my own desire for my messy drama generally. More generally, they both theoretically have flaws, but you only know this because the narration keeps explicitly saying what they are and how they’re growing past them instead of them ever really, like, meaningfully fucking them over or causing them to be unsympathetic.
Our protagonist also just had an utter surfeit of self-knowledge – her internal monologue sometimes reads more like the author’s notes on the character’s passions, neuroses and flaws than anything anyone would actually think about themselves. Especially someone in her position. And all the therapy-speak just really made me grind my teeth (not least because whatever the book says, there’s no way she’d able to afford the regular therapist sessions she apparently has on regular retail wages. Which is a minor thing but a) it really does annoy me, and b) it feels telling.)
And, fundamentally, the book just kind of took itself too seriously? Or, more properly, given how utterly absurd the premise and most of the set-pieces were, it just wasn’t nearly funny enough. Or horrifying enough, if you wanted to go the other way – there’s the raw material for some decent creepypasta style horror there, but that would kind of undercut how wholesome and uplifting nad etc the narrative’s clearly supposed to be.
So yeah, ended up using some amazing conceits and occasionally great visuals to construct a pretty tepid adventure story around an emotional core that didn’t feel real to me. What a pity.

With the terror attacks of 11 September 2001, millennial “end of history” optimism came to an abrupt halt. Fear of Islam and Muslims surged across the West. In the Middle East, the hopes of peace sustained by the Oslo Process during the 1990s had already come to end with the outbreak of the Second Intifada in September 2000 and the coming to power of George W. Bush and Ariel Sharon in early 2001. After 9/11, violence and death in Israel and Palestine became, in the eyes of many, the most vivid theatre of the new “war on terror.” This established the interpretation of the Palestine-Israel conflict as a frontline battle over the validity of that worldview. The polarization of global perceptions of the violence in the Middle East posed a potential crisis for the consensus support that had been forged in the 1990s for Holocaust memory as redemptive anti-antisemitism. It was no longer so straightforward to draw a universalistic lesson from empathy with victimhood, and from the antisemitic persecution of Jews in particular, when one of the key fronts of the conflict between Jews and Palestinians was for international public empathy. Images of empty Israeli cafés, deserted due to fear of suicide bombers, vied for media attention and public sympathy, in the spring of 2002, against images of the rubble of Jenin and other Palestinian settlements assaulted by Israeli forces.
—Adam Sutcliffe, "Whose Feelings Matter? Holocaust Memory, Empathy, and Redemptive Anti-Antisemitism," from the Journal of Genocide Research

Olivia Rodrigo - Guts
Second album from the American singer and actress produced by Dan Nigro
9/13
Tumblr media
There was a moment, in the first half of 2021, where adults felt a pressing need to announce to the world why they liked Olivia Rodrigo. The young, bright-eyed Disney Channel actress and songwriter had just gone through her first teenage heartbreak, and had poured her emotions into a “drivers license” (her devastating first single that topped the charts), and then again on her debut album, SOUR—which also topped the charts, won a few Grammys and catapulted the 17-year-old into global pop stardom.
Socially starved, we relished living through her innocence and naivety as she navigated her deep pain. We cried remembering high school heartbreaks that may or may not have happened (though, shockingly, first heartbreaks can actually happen at any age). We used the words “nostalgic” and “geriatric” and “millennial” a lot. What does all that outsized attention do to a teenager with no chance to hone her craft on a smaller stage, whose debut was already hailed as a classic, generation defining voice? In a 2021 piece for The Ringer, Julia Gray noted of our fascination with Rodrigo’s age and SOUR’s ‘00s-era musical influences as a “fixation with dated pop culture relics…We don’t see Olivia Rodrigo for who she is as an artist, but who she is when we project ourselves onto her.”
It’s fitting then, that Rodrigo’s second album, GUTS, begins with “all-american bitch,” an ironic gem that arrives as a gentle, folksy ballad before making a heel turn into a pop punk kiss-off to her idolizers: “I am built like a mother and a total machine,” she sings angelically over a light, fairytale-like guitar plucking. When the full band kicks in and rocks out in the chorus, it’s apparent just how much the now-20-year-old has been holding in all these years: “I don’t get angry when I’m pissed / I’m the eternal optimist / I scream inside to deal with it,” she chants, tauntingly, before actually screaming her guts out. This is about more than just adulthood: GUTS is a brash, sobering look at the totality of fame on a young woman—how it consumes, abuses and isolates.
On SOUR, Rodrigo wore her sadness and rage as armor; her emotions were intense but predictable; and the music hinted at a brighter sky beyond the stormy weather. Not so on GUTS, where bad decisions are encouraged, death is preferable over socializing and every playboy can be fixed. On the dizzy, jangly-rock “bad idea right?,” she willingly ignores her mind’s rational pleas to have one more tryst with an ex, while on the soaring ballad “logical,” she attempts to reason with her own lovesick feelings by believing the impossible: “‘Cause if rain don’t pour and sun don’t shine / Then changing you is possible / I guess love is never logical.” The stakes are higher in these new loves built on power and age differentials—and the consequences cut a lot deeper. “I know I’m half-responsible / And that makes me feel horrible,” she repeatedly sings near the song’s end, soft and fragile, embedded in a wilting layer of synths.
There’s so much self-deprecation and internalized blaming here, which could be viewed as a depressing cry for help if it wasn’t so much fun to listen to. Rodrigo, along with her songwriting and producing partner Dan Nigro, plays with abrupt changes in voice and structure in these otherwise heady tracks, as if to signal that she knows just how absurd she’s being. “ballad of a homeschooled girl,” a rollicking, bratty emo highlight, has her crying out in embarrassment over the most minuscule social faux-pas in a breathless chorus: “I broke a glass, I tripped and fell / I told secrets I shouldn’t tell / I stumped over all my words / I made it weird, I made it worse.” Soaring into a dispiriting line that sounds euphoric—“Each time I step outside / It’s social suicide”—Rodrigo quickly dips into a nonchalant chorus of “ahs,” dismissing her anxious headspace with a shrug.
Meanwhile, the raucous “get him back!” almost positions her as drunk and pleading to a friend at a party, as she raps in a muffled tone trying to make the case for her cheating ex: “But he was so much fun and he had such weird friends / And he would take us out to parties and the night would never end.” A sing-songy chorus drives the point home, as she flutters between what she really wants (“I want sweet revenge and I want him again”)—but it’s the track’s bridge where Rodrigo lets her rage boil up. “I wanna key his car / I wanna make him lunch,” she quietly sneers amid backing chants and a choppy guitar, ramping up the viciousness of her anger and letting it out in a gleeful squeal.
And yet, even with all of Rodrigo’s Kathleen Hanna yelps and fiery screams, I almost wish GUTS was a little more punk than it is rock: Its production seems too clean at times, its fadeouts too exact, and its structural changes too accurate. But the honesty of her rage is still refreshing and, at times, comes across as more earnest than the debut single that turned her into a superstar. Beneath the cannonball of her voice and the album’s thunderous sounds, there is a soft fragility waiting to be absorbed. Anger comes from having no total grasp of the unknown, from the realization that growth is a never ending process.
On SOUR’s opening track, Rodrigo wished for her own “teenage dream;” now that phrase titles GUTS album closer—a reflective lament on the pressures of fame and the fear of not living up to the world’s expectations: “They all say that it gets better / It gets better the more you grow,” she lightly sighs, “They all say that it gets better / It gets better, but what if I don’t?” Raising her voice from that fluttering falsetto to a stronger, yet panicked belt, Rodrigo brings her deepest fears to the surface. These are emotions you don’t need to reminisce on, as long as you let them float within you—as long as you know when to let them go.

sorry for posting hp on here but i think most of the audience grumbling at the fact that snape acted too badly to be regarded so positively by harry and co after his death comes from the fact that a british gen x author wrote a character who, in her view, acted a cunt but not much different than many employed real life teachers she had probably known, but the american millennial and gen z audiences see the *exact same* character and behavior and are absolutely horrified at the meanness. can’t believe this book is normalizing abuse lol. as the comment itself admits, this is confirmed by the fact that none of the other teachers are phased by snape’s behavior (indicating he’s not particularly out of line by the story’s internal logic - compare with say, umbridge, whose behavior other teachers clearly disapprove of) and he seems to be a respected member of staff so like. that’s it.
the reason it “doesn’t get addressed” or whatever is because jk genuinely didn’t think snape needed a character moment or redemption exclusively for being mean to kids (and honestly neither do i lol. his role was to provide entertainment and low stakes tension when the main characters were having their more childish adventures) — but changing mores have made this a problem for the fandom

144 Hours in Taiwan: OCAC Recap
Tumblr media
Not by popular opinion, I truly believe that summer is the prime season to visit Taiwan. I have always noticed an undeniable feverish buzz that permeates through the city, especially during the summers. As Taiwan is very community-focused, there is always a wide variety of emerging pop-up shops, community fairs and local events to participate in – everyday truly feels like a new adventure!I created a video mash of highlights from this trip using the app, 1SecondEveryday
Embarking on a week-long journey with my #taclfam
Earlier this summer, I joined a total of 38 representatives and leaders from various TAP chapters, TACL National Board (our parent organization), Political Internship Program (PIP) and Leading Youth Forward (LYF) camp to embark on a week-long adventure to Taiwan. This trip was sponsored by OCAC (Overseas Community Affairs Council), a cabinet-level council whose main purpose is to create international programs to further bridge the gap between Taiwan and America by engaging Taiwanese youth. In the past, I’ve primarily only visited Taiwan to spend time with family so I was excited to embark on this journey with an entirely new group of people.
As the purpose of this overseas trip is to engage millennial professionals, we participated in a lot of government-related activities such as lectures, workshops and tours. We visited the Ministry of Foreign Affairs and also toured the Presidential Office Building, which is currently in its 100th anniversary of being built! One of the biggest highlights of this trip was participating in a formal cabinet-level discussion with the Vice President, Chen Chien-Jen (陳建仁), where we were encouraged to speak our minds and ask any questions we had in regards to Taiwan. It was definitely super informative to hear more about his perspective on certain topics as well as his ideas on how we can be more active in further bridging that gap.
Group photo with the Vice President
We also attended workshops where we learned about industries in Taiwan, indigenous tribes and even got to interact with working professionals! In my visits back, I seldom encounter TA professionals who have successfully uprooted their life in the States to make “the big move” to work in Taiwan. One standout professional’s workshop that I had the pleasure of attending was named Sunny Yang. A Teach-for-America alumni, Sunny works as the Director of Licensing for a non-profit organization called “City Wanderer.” City Wanderer is an educational program that utilizes gamification as an innovative way to aspire youth to step outside of their comfort zones and discover the limitless prospects for their future.
How the game works: In teams of three, participants are assigned a total of 30 “missions” to complete within a three-week period. The missions vary in that they challenge the youth to engage with minorities, interact with other cultural groups and more.
In a way, I see a lot of similarities with City Wanderer and one of the events that I spearhead called ‘The Amazing TAP Race,’ except that it is more targeted and purposeful. After attending the workshop, I was brimming with ideas on how to reiterate and potentially expand the gameplay to enter different avenues and territories for social impact!
Getting in touch with our cultural roots
Of course, this trip wasn’t entirely focused on professional because, I mean, what fun would that be? It just wouldn’t be Taiwan without the obligatory cultural excursions that help educate us about Taiwanese history.
During our visit to the largest interactive museum in Taiwan, PingLin Tea Museum (坪林茶業博物館), we learned firsthand about the tea-making process and how tea differs from culture to culture. Did you know that in the country of Turkey that if you have a crush on somebody, you add sugar to the other person’s cup of tea? On the other hand, if you ever taste a hint of salt in your tea, you might want to avoid that person in the future…

Existence, well, what does it matter?
The focus of Module 3 is "Climate Crisis". Admittedly, I only knew what the mainstream has tried to put across through news of receding glaciers, frequent wildfires, and the rising costs of oil. So, I decided to do my own reading.
Most people would think that the world's dependence on oil is only as recent as the invention of the combustion engine and vehicles based on the use of petroleum-based resources of oil. Humanity has been burning oils of various forms since ancient times, certainly, Roman oil lamps burned the possibly eco-friendlier olive oil to slow the burning of a wick, but olive oil doesn't meet the 21st century's oil needs. Humanity also nearly drove several species of whale to extinction for our need for oils to be burned from the 19th century onward. In 1946 the International Whaling Commission was founded with the intention of keeping whale species from being hunted to death.
However, I digress, it has been widely established in the scientific community that the burning of fossil fuels is the dominant cause of global warming. Since the Industrial Revolution of the 1800s, we have changed the face of the globe, not only by increasing the amount of fossil fuels we burn, but also how we use the land we inhabit. In many parts of the world, vast swathes of forests have been cleared, also releasing vast stores of carbon, that trees naturally store and live on, into the atmosphere, also contributing to the heating up of the planet. While trees might soak up some ambient carbon in the atmosphere, they can only do so much as it would take time for the forests to help restore climate equilibrium. We are certainly seeing in the news a prevalence of forest wildfires happening around the world. With the carbon reserves in those forests being instantly released into the atmosphere.
Speaking of gases being released into the environment - the food industry has a large responsibility for this. The food industry accounts for 28% of the world's greenhouse gas emissions, making it one of the single largest contributors to climate change. The highest emissions of Co2 come from the farming of cattle and dairy meats, because we farm them en masse to accommodate for global demand, the methane emissions from animal waste and enteric fermentation release along with indirect emission from land use having been cleared by deforestation. As a meat eater, I was shocked to learn this. I have been trying to buy local to reduce my part in food miles, but given the current cost of living crisis, this has become harder to achieve.
For my part, I have heard of but never really explored the activism surrounding climate change. There are many groups whose purpose is to raise awareness and to actively stop climate change ranging from the well-known Extinction Rebellion and Just Stop Oil, to the oft overlooked but established Greenpeace and Rainforest Alliance. Being born to what is called Generation Y, I am known as a millennial. The age range I am in was made aware of climate change in dribs and drabs and since our transition from analogue to digital, we are somewhere in strange place between expecting to have information delivered to us by the media but also not quite realising that we have to seek out further news information from other digital platforms. By this paradox of expecting to be informed but not being, we found ourselves in a weird depression of the world in crisis, and apathy of not quite knowing how to tackle the issue as it never was reported as being something that could be altered, certainly not realising that the cost of reversing it would mean fundamentally altering the world around us. Of course, I cannot personally speak for my entire generation, these are just my own views and perspectives on how it appears my generation responded to climate change. I feel regret that we have somehow passed the buck to Generation Z to solve the climate crisis. I can honestly say they seem to be more in command of their confidences and innovative in their solutions than my generation were at their age.
It was noted in the early days of the COVID pandemic, that levels of Co2 gases showed a decline because of the lockdowns in place around the world. This showed that it is not fundamentally too late to alter the climate emergency we are seeing. We need to keep fossil fuels where they are, not go digging for every last drop. We need to push for more renewable energy and if it doesn't meet our current energy needs, reconsider if we need them to survive. Switch to renewable foods and reconsider our dependency on what we eat.
For my part, I feel that what is being done so far is not enough, and as a civilisation we need to be shaken from our apathy and dependence on such world destabilising resources, maybe the forest fires are the worlds way of lighting a beacon of warning?

Engaging Employees Through Sustainability
So you want to start an employee engagement program? BBMG recently released a white paper that addresses sustainability as an organizational core value, which not only helps the planet but also increases employee engagement. Their rationale is that having this type of transcendent vision gives employees purpose and empowerment, if executed correctly.
BBMG’s data links sustainability to the rising Millennial generation (born between 1980-2000), including:
86% of Millennials would consider leaving an employer whose social responsibility values no longer reflected their own.
79% of Millennials would likely accept a job at an eco-friendly company over a conventional one.
About 55% of men and women under 30 believe it’s very or extremely important to work for a company that is socially and environmentally responsible.
BBMG provides some guidance on how to create a sustainability strategy that engages employees at all levels and generations. After partnering with Wal-Mart to create a global platform for an employee sustainability program, they were able to share the content with other organizations and individuals around the world. There are too many tips to list here, so I highly suggest reading their white paper to learn more.
Some of the interesting and most important phases of setting up a sustainability program were:
1. Make the strategy actionable and flexible
When working with Wal-Mart, BBMG created 12 broad categories of actions that employees could choose from. Though some employees may be extremely proactive, others may be unsure where to start, so give concrete actions that employees can engage in.
Flexibility comes by creating different phases that are slowly rolled out during the program. If your organization is geographically dispersed, let each branch define how they interpret those phases.
2. Make it rewarding
BBMG suggests creating friendly competitions and quirky rewards.
3. Internal communications are key
Create brown-bag lunch series, employee webinars, or breakfast panels.
Place communication material in areas where employees gather; the lunchroom, restrooms and elevators are popular spots.
4. Celebrate success
This could be the most important part of the program. How are you measuring success? Do you have a baseline? Success stories, small and large, are what spur engagement and motivation. How can you share these stories most effectively and also encourage employees to share their own? Facebook, intranets, email newsletters, company blogs and social media outlets are some ideas.
